Abstract
Second harmonic generation in reflection has been used to investigate the crystal properties of silicon carbide surfaces. By using a passively modeβlocked pulsed Nd^3+^: YAG laser the variation of the crystalline, polycrystalline and amorphous phase of silicon carbide at the surface has been investigated. The method is shown to be a sensitive and practical method to investigate the departure from perfect crystalline order at the surface.
